I recently checked out the premiere of JJ Villards Fairytales and it is a twisted fairytale animated horror show.
If you enjoy dark humor, surreal animation, horror and fairytales , be sure to check this show out.
The first episode was crazy. The story is a twisted version of the Rapunzel fairytale which has been adapted many times by such shows as Hallmarks Timeless tales fairytales for all ages animated series, the Disney film Tangled and more. If you have never read or heard of this fairytale before, this episode will introduce you to this fairytale in a very weird way by introducing you to boypunzel and his adventure in JJ's Fairytale World.
I thought the voice cast did a great job in this episode too. This show casts an ensemble of Horror and other voice actors from Doug Bradley to Robert Englund and more. I don't know who did the voices for episode 1 but they did an amazing job.
I look forward to checking out more of this show which it's dark gross twisted humor reminded me of the show Ren and Stimpy when they premiere the episodes on the Adult Swim website and see what fairytales will get the horror adaptation next.
I definitely reccomend this show to Horror fans 18 and over. Great job to the Creator and voice cast thus far!
I give it 9/10 stars.

There's so much that offending for offending sake's can take you, specially in this day and age when that is truly meaningless.
Instead of being genuinely subversive this show just takes the immature route of being gratuitously gross and offensive, there is very little cleverness unless you find characters making wonky random faces with random wonky editing something that creative or endearing. It feels like it tries to be an edgier version of the first season of south park but made by someone that did not understood anything that made a show like south park appealing when it first aired, and of course, this comes more than 20 years later after south park aired, when no one really cares about the "oh no they didn't" type of grade school humor that looks like it came out of the mind of the cartoonist protagonist played by Tom Green in "freddy got fingered" or some highschool flash animator in the early 00s newsgrounds.
Be assured, I am not rating the show so low because i am morally appalled or because i am queasy but rather because i found it trite and thoroughly unpleasant, not because of the controversial nature but for the lack of any redeemable features or a genuine intention to be creative or funny accompanying it. This show is just a compilation of mean spirited bits thrown against a wall expecting some kind of special gold star for being "so out there"

The concept is really good, putting a darker twist on fairy tales, but the execution is just meh. This show is so weird that I can't even fit it into my usual review format.
The art is really nice, and so is the voice acting, but I loathe the way the characters move. Unlike South Park, where it's like that on purpose, here it just seems like a way to cut corners.
There's also a lot of blood, gore, and gross-out, so I wouldn't recommend it to anyone who's squeamish of those things. Then again, I'm pretty sure the creator of this show also worked on the infamous gross-out show King Star King.
I think this show would work better as a direct adaptation of the fairy tales aired in a primetime slot, making them as dark as they originally were, but with better animation, more believable characters, and less gross-out.
2018 and 2019 were such good years for adult animation, we got masterpieces like Primal. Final Space, and Tuca & Bertie. What the heck happened in 2020? The Midnight Gospel, Solar Opposites, and this show all were disappointing to me. Duncanville is alright but not the best thing ever. Hopefully Crossing Swords and Central Park are good.
